\A RESOLUTION

CD
WHEREAS, Saturday, May 26, 2018 the City of Chicago will be commemorating Memorial Day; and

WHEREAS, Honorable James A. Balcer will be retiring as a member of the Memorial Day Committee. He has served on this Committee for the last twenty (20) years in honoring the men and women who gave their lives in service protecting our nation's freedom; and

WHEREAS, The Chicago City Council has been informed of his retirement by the Honorable Patrick D. Thompson, Alderman of the 11th Ward; and

WHEREAS, Honorable James A. Balcer began his career as Director of Veteran Affairs for the City of Chicago, a position he held from 1989 to 1997; and served as Alderman of the 11th ward for eighteen years; and

WHEREAS, Honorable James A. Balcer has also served as Chairman of the Parade and as emcee for the parade on State Street; and also provided live commentary on ABC 7 when it was broadcast live; as well as the Wreath Laying Ceremony at the Eternal Flame at Daley Plaza; and

WHEREAS, Honorable James A. Balcer unwavering devotion to honor our veterans for the sacrifices they have made in defense of our freedom, and to ensure that they and their families are properly cared for and never forgotten; and

WHEREAS, Honorable James A. Balcer in 2002 was the recipient of the Major General John A. Logan Award as an outstanding individual whose patriotism, leadership and selfless devotion to the men and women in America's Armed Forces and the City of Chicago who go above and beyond their civilian and non-civilian duties; and
